Meanwhile, Estonia went up one spot to 29th and Latvia dropped from the 49th to 54th , said Statistics Lithuania.

Lithuania’s showing was the worst in innovations and business sophistication, ranking 44th in the subindex, with business sophistication listed as the worst at 46 th and innovations a bit better at 41st.

The country was listed 40th in the subindex of efficiency enhancers and 34th in the subindex of main requirements.

For the ninth consecutive year, the World Economic Forum listed Switzerland as the most competitive country, followed by the United States of America and Singapore.
